作者:王皓发布于:2014-03-22 04:48更新于:2014-03-28 17:29阿里云的云服务器(ECS)可以选择多种操作系统,打算用它运行 Drupal 或者 WordPress ,你最好选择 Linux 系统,这篇文章的演示是基于阿里云的 CentOS 操作系统的服务器。我们在上面搭建一个 nginx +
前言NFS(Network File System)意为网络文件系统,它最大的功能就是可以通过网络,让不同的机器不同的操作系统可以共享彼此的文件。简单的讲就是可以挂载远程主机的共享目录到本地,就像操作本地磁盘一样,非常方便的操作远程文件。本文将给大家讲解如何在CentOS7上安装和配置NFS服务器。下面话不多说了,来一起看看详细的介绍吧准备我们需要两台CentOS7机器,我们用虚拟机做测试,分别做
1.RocketMQ-Cluster集群搭建1.1.说明RocketMQ是一款分布式消息中间件,其各方面的性能都比目前已有的消息队列要好。RocketMQ默认采用长轮询的拉模式,单机支持千万级别的消息堆积,可以非常好的应用在海量消息系统中。 集群的模式有四种,单master模式、多master模式、多master多slave异步复制模式、多master多slave同步复制模式,推荐生产环境使用多m
环境搭建和基础代码的使用Windows 版本下载地址:http://rocketmq.apache.org/release_notes/配置系统环境变量配置系统变量ROCKETMQ_HOME=“D:\soft\rocketmq-all-4.5.1-bin-release”,如下图所示: 注意:每个人 rocketmq 存放目录不一样,要根据自己文件的位置进行配置环境变量因为接下来启动 mqname
先把rocketmq上传到/hom/data/目录下;为了方便,我们统一用finalshell工具上传;/home/下面再新建一个mq目录用来存放rocketmq安装文件;进入data目录,解压rocketmq压缩包到mq目录unzip rocketmq-all-4.9.0-bin-release.zip -d ../mq
原创 2021-09-22 16:39:52
10000+阅读
 一、RocketMQ 简介RocketMQ 是一个由 Java 语言编写的分布式高性能消息中间件,由阿里创建,后将其开源给 Apache 基金会,现在已经成为 Apache 开源项目中的顶级开源项目,具有高性能、高可靠、高实时、分布式特点,尤其内部封装了很多跟业务相关的功能模块,能让我们快速用其解决业务上消息处理的一些难点,所以如何使用与部署 RocketMQ 是这里要讲的重点。
原创 精选 2024-05-06 00:57:56
465阅读
1评论
好的!下面是 RocketMQ 搭建部署指南(适用于生产/测试环境),适用于你这种 Java + SpringBoot 场景,并为后续微服务架构预留了空间。? 一、RocketMQ 组件结构(简要)组件作用NameServer服务注册中心,记录 Broker 地址Broker存储和转发消息的核心组件Producer消息生产者(你的 Spring Boot 服务)Consumer消息消费者(你的 S
原创 2月前
155阅读
介绍RocketMQ是阿里巴巴2016年MQ中间件,使用Java语言开发,在阿里内部,RocketMQ承接了例如“双11”等高并发场景的消息流转,能够处理万亿级别的消息。下载RocketMQ下载地址反应有点慢点击后等一下就好了!下载后解压我们将下载后的程序包上传Linux服务器运行1.启动NameServer# 1.启动NameServer,后台启动nohup sh bin/mqnamesrv &# 2.查看启动日志tail -f ~/logs/rocketmqlogs
原创 2022-12-01 17:07:41
105阅读
一、环境准备:Centos 7,jdk1.8运行环境,maven,git,未安装的可自行百度安装奥,这里就不在介绍了二、软件包准备:提供2种方式下载 一:直接通过官网下载bin包,解压使用 1. 下载地址:http://rocketmq.apache.org/release_notes/release-notes-4.2.0/ 2. wget http://mirror.bit.e
转载 2024-06-18 14:10:54
82阅读
目录 一、部署架构二、环境准备三、部署nameServera、机器Ab、机器B四、部署broker a、机器A配置b、机器B配置五、启动broker六、安装console客户端一、部署架构本次搭建RocketMQ集群是双主双从的高可用模式,目前因为机器有限,所有使用的是两台Linux服务器。服务器名称ip角色机器A192.168.0.1nameServer、master:br
转载 2023-12-17 12:08:24
153阅读
RocketMQ集群安装在上一节*RocketMQ安装*中,已经安装成功了RocketMQ;现在需要将上一节的虚拟机复制两台出来,组件rocketMq的集群。Tips:复制后的虚拟机,先修改网络配置文件(vim /etc/sysconfig/network-scripts/ifcfg-ens33)中的IP地址(IPADDR),避免重复。并使用systemctl restart network重启网
转载 2023-09-27 20:29:31
223阅读
RocketMQ——RocketMQ搭建及问题解决 文章目录RocketMQ——RocketMQ搭建及问题解决RocketMQ简介RocketMQ安装下载地址系统要求准备工作单机模式安装启动nameserver启动broker测试关闭消息队列问题解决方案集群搭建启动NameServer启动broker修改配置文件修改机器1的配置文件(192.168.108.128)修改机器2的配置文件(192.1
目录标题一、相关推荐二、基本架构图:三、集群模式1、单Master模式(这种单节点的理论上不叫集群)2、多Master模式3、多Master多Slave模式(异步)4、多Master多Slave模式(同步)5、开始搭建(多Master多Slave模式)5.1、准备(!!搭建失败了)5.2、修改Brocker配置文件5.3、启动四、消息发送样例1、导入pom依赖2、运行测试五、rocketmq的工
准备工作:一、首先准备linux环境 使用了两个虚拟机系统 版本为Centos 7  ip地址固定为192.168.194.128 192.168.194.129 安装好JDK MAVEN 配置好对应环境变量二、RocketMQ的集群模式有很多种:单Master(可用性低 不安全) 多Master(无Slave) 多Master多Slave对于有主有从的模式,其中集群的写模式分
##角色介绍 Producer:消息的发送者; 举例:发信者 Consumer:消息接收者;举例:收信者 Broker:暂存和传输消息;举例:邮局 NameServer:管理Broker;举例:各个邮局的管理机构 Topic:区分消息的种类; 一个发送者可以发送消息给一个或者多个Topic;一个消息 ...
转载 2021-09-17 16:49:00
198阅读
2评论
broker组1: # NameServer地址 namesrvAddr=192.168.1.100: 9876;192.168.1.101: 9876 # 集群名称 brokerClusterName=itzhai-com-cluster # brokerIP地址 brokerIP1=192.16
原创 2022-09-02 23:48:37
166阅读
简单研究下其集群策略以及集群搭建方式。 参考: https://github.com/apache/rocketmq/blob/master/docs/cn/operation.md 1. 集群架构图 2. 数据复制与刷盘策略 复制策略: 指的是broker的主从节点之间的数据同步方式,分为同步复制
原创 2022-01-18 13:53:10
989阅读
RocketMQ搭建分为4种方式 单Master模式:风险大,宕机或重启服务不可用 多Master模式:单台宕机,整体服务不受影响,但此节点上未消费的消息在节点恢复之前不可被消费 多Master多Slave模式(异步):因为是异步复制,主备有短暂消息延迟(毫秒级),Master宕机,磁盘损坏情况下会
# 如何使用Docker搭建RocketMQ ## 介绍 欢迎来到Docker和RocketMQ的世界!在本文中,我将教会你如何使用Docker来搭建RocketMQ。无论你是刚入行的小白还是经验丰富的开发者,都可以跟随以下步骤来完成这个任务。 ## 流程图 ```mermaid flowchart TD A(准备工作) --> B(下载RocketMQ镜像) B --> C(
原创 2024-06-19 06:10:12
57阅读
1、RocketMQ介绍1.1.简介RocketMQ是一款分布式、队列模型的消息中间件,具有以下特点:能够保证严格的消息顺序提供丰富的消息拉取模式高效的订阅者水平扩展能力实时的消息订阅机制亿级消息堆积能力选用理由:强调集群无单点,可扩展,任意一点高可用,水平可扩展。海量消息堆积能力,消息堆积后,写入低延迟。支持上万个队列消息失败重试机制消息可查询开源社区活跃成熟度(经过双十一考验)1.2.关键概念
转载 2017-12-24 17:32:27
951阅读
  • 1
  • 2
  • 3
  • 4
  • 5